>> I notice that Trusty no longer uses xscreensaver but instead uses the
>> LockScreen app.
>
> xscreensaver was dropped from the default install in 8.04 ...
>
> from 8.04 til trusty ubuntu used gnome-screensaver ... which was
> discontinued upstream (since the screensaver became a gnome-shell
> function)
>
> with trusty the screensaver became a unity module ....
>
> i think there is an option in the unity-tweak tool to disable the
> builtin screensaver in unity so you could just install xscreensaver and
> use it instead.
